That right there is why College Football is amazing. Great back and forth game.
Obviously I'm extremely disappointed. Score 47 points on the road and still lose. I wanted Van Gorder gone after year 1 and still have no idea why Kelly has kept him around for 3 years. They should leave his ass in Austin.
The defense was just awful today. After ND scored in OT I was hoping they would've gone for 2. I like Zaire but the guy must look amazing in practice for Kelly to want to play both him and Kizer. It was a mistake to keep flip flopping every drive.
Kizer is just the better player. NFL scouts are salivating at a 6"4 230lbs QB who can throw dimes like that as well as move the chains with his legs.
Oh well, it's a long season and if you're going to lose you better lose early. This is a tough one.
